Coinbase’s Latest Financial Shenanigans: Stablecoin Fund Reloaded
Coinbase (Nasdaq: COIN) decided to announce on Aug. 12, 2025, that they’re launching a second Stablecoin Bootstrap Fund. Managed by Coinbase Asset Management (CBAM), it’s supposed to increase stablecoin liquidity in DeFi capital markets. 🤑 Starting with Aave, Morpho, Kamino, and Jupiter, because why not throw money at everything?
Our goal is to ensure deeper liquidity for stablecoins across the onchain ecosystem, enabling users to access reliable rates across mature and emerging protocols.

The original Stablecoin Bootstrap Fund, launched in 2019 after Coinbase helped create USD Coin (USDC), supported liquidity on platforms like Uniswap, Compound, and dYdX. That early boost helped USDC grow into the DeFi darling it is today, with $8.9 billion in total value locked and $2.7 trillion in annual onchain transaction volume. 🚀
Now, USDC operates on multiple blockchains-Ethereum, Base, Solana, Hyperliquid, Sui, and Aptos. Coinbase sees these as critical to its mission of advancing onchain finance infrastructure and adoption. Translation: More chains, more problems. 🤦♂️
Coinbase plans to scale this relaunch over time, expanding coverage to more protocols and stablecoins. Some analysts worry this could increase systemic risk, while others see it as a way to enhance protocol stability, stimulate market growth, and improve capital efficiency.
